Educational Guide

The European Union’s and the Council of Europe’s educational tool titled “Managing Controversy. Developing a strategy for handling controversy and teaching controversial issues in schools.” mainly addresses school principals and officials in school education as a means to empower them promote handling controversy educational practices within their school community.

The school year 2018-2019 this tool has been translated in Greek language and has been the main educational material introduced to the Greek teaching community through a series of training workshops that took place at Thessaloniki, Ioannina, Achaia, Heraklion and Lesvos regions. The above mentioned activities were included in the project “MICRON! – Managing Issues of Controversy by human Rights educatiON!” that ANTIGONE realised with the financial contribution of the European Union and the Council of Europe under Democratic and Inclusive School Culture in Operation (DISCO) Programme. This has been the project that inspired our partnership for the implementation of “Sharing Knowledge Handling Controversy in Schools of Greece, North Macedonia and Bulgaria” the material of which is presented in the present website.
